New Zealand’s Conway out of T20 final after breaking hand punching bat

Read more Stead told “It looked a pretty innocuous reactionary incident on the field but the blow obviously caught the bat between the glove padding and while it’s not the smartest thing he’s done there’s certainly an element of bad luck in the injury. “Devon is a great team man and a very popular member of the side so we’re all feeling for him.” New Zealand will replace Conway with Tim Seifert, who has not played a match since the Black Caps were well beaten by Pakistan in their tournament opener over two weeks ago. Conway batted at No 4 against England but Seifert, who was seventh in the order against Pakistan, would be unlikely to replace his teammate in the higher slot. “Whether we bring Glenn Phillips up one and put Seifert in behind him is something that Kane [Williamson] and I have to work through over the next day or so,” said Stead.

"Started Giving Back To Him": Devon Conway On MS Dhoni's Quirky One

Conway, who was named the player of the match in the final against Gujarat Titans, lauded skipper Dhoni for the way he mentored him this season. The Kiwi star also revealed that Dhoni has been giving him plenty of banter but now, he has started to give it back to the 'Thala'. "I've been lucky to spend quite a lot of time with him. Moeen, MS, [Ajinkya] Rahane and I spent a lot of time in the team room watching a lot of IPL games, talking about different teams and strategies, and in general, life beyond cricket. The relationship I have with MS is cool; he gives me a lot of banter and chirp, quirky one-liners. Now I've started to give it back to him (laughs)," Listen to the During the chat, Conway also spoke about the 'aura' that Dhoni has which makes everyone speak to him, and seek guidance. "The respect is immense. Every time he walks into a room, there's an aura around him. You want to talk to him, understand what he has to say because of his status in cricket and what he has achieved. We were fortunate to play a lot of snooker late nights and early mornings. MS and I were in one team and would often play Moeen and his close friend Tanvir, practically his godson. And our games would start shortly after heading back to the hotel from a match to around 2-3 am. We've shared a lot of laughs and good, constructive chats around those games and how to approach different situations and those sorts of things," the New Zealand batter revealed.

Devon Conway

How unique was the three-day T20 that culminated in CSK's fifth IPL title? Very unique - an emotional rollercoaster. I had many cups of chai just to keep myself going that late at night when we were all waiting during the rain break, not knowing how many overs we'd get in our chase. It was a little unsettling. Just before going in to bat, Were you surprised to get the Player-of-the-Match award in the final? Oh, yeah. For sure. I thought Sai Sudharsan played an unbelievable knock. Jaddu himself had an incredible game with bat and ball. Ambati Rayudu's cameo didn't seem like much but it was certainly game-changing. So yeah, I was surprised, but at the end of the day, I don't worry about winning or missing out on individual awards. Winning trophies together as a group is what I dream of. Did you go "oops" after you woke up to a social media storm for saying it was the ( Laughs) It was about 3.30am in the morning. We were going through so many emotions, and I probably said it without realising what I meant. Of course, winning the WTC final was unbelievable and truly a highlight, but certainly this win was also very much up there with what I've achieved so far. A few [New Zealand] lads kept bantering with me for a few hours after that, but it was all good. What is it about CSK that makes players want to go the extra mile?
